Methow River

Fishing today with Garn Christensen on the Methow above the confluence with the Twisp. I caught five cutts, one rainbow, lots of missed strikes. Garn caught lots on the dries.
My first fish were on black stonefly nymph with bead head, nothing on the prince nymph dropper. When the fish started hitting the Thingamabobber I decided to change to dries. Good choice! Had some big fish attack (I missed) the golden stone fly dry that was my dropper, a few to a chernoble (orange) bug that was my lead fly.
